Aída had met Cacho, the one from the marchas cañeras, the one who was always on foot, the one of uruguayan folk music.
—Tell me everything! —her cousin Marta said, impatient.
—He’s kind, he’s helpful, and his smile is so wide it lights everything up.
—But tell me everything, Aída. Have you kissed yet?
Aída was from Villa Española, a neighborhood girl, Elsa’s daughter, Carlos’s sister, the one who went around with her CASMU friends. That day she didn’t answer her cousin’s question—she just smiled.
